Q. Consider the following reaction
$xMnO_{4}^{-}+yC_{2}O_{4}^{2 -}+zH^{+} \rightarrow xMn^{2 +}+2yCO_{2}+\frac{z}{2}H_{2}O$
The values of x, y and z in the reaction are, respectively

Solution:

$2MnO_{4}^{-}+5C_{2}O_{4}^{2 -}+16H^{+} \rightarrow 2Mn^{2 +}+10CO_{2}+8H_{2}O$
Here $x = 2, y = 5$ and $z = 16$.
